Ruby The Red Worm’s Dirty Job
Written by Scott Stoll
Illustrated by the Waukesha STEM Academy elementary school
Children’s chapter book
Ages 5-12 and beyond
Synopsis: Ruby the Red Worm is a humorous and educational introduction to composting and the essential role worms serve in the ecosystem. More importantly, it is a story about living a life of passion despite life’s bullies — even if it means eating dirt!
Description: These books were part of the Make-A-Book Project. The stories are both educational and inspirational. The stories are written by Scott and illustrated by elementary students and jam-packed with fun surprises and suggested activities. The black and white pages leave plenty of room so children can add their own drawings and colors.
